SPORTING NEWS.
TRAINING NOTES. [By Gipsy Gp.anli.] The usual number of horses were on the track this morning. Hopeful, Otaier:. Forty Winks, a 11J Cleve were set at the steeplechase course. Gtiri pulled out the first round. Forty Winks antl Hopeful finishing in good style. Solitaire andOtaieri were associated over the schooling fences, the Australian-bred mare moving in great style. Moore, the Australian jockey, was in the saddle on Hopeful this morning, and the son of Puriri negotiated the big country better than he has ever done before. A number of others were restricted to gentle exercise.
